A leading utilities infrastructure provider is seeking a Site Manager in Berwick-upon-Tweed to lead operations on a multi-million-pound framework. You will ensure projects are delivered safely and efficiently, while fostering a positive team environment.
Ideal candidates will possess strong leadership skills and a relevant engineering qualification.
Benefits include:
- Competitive salary
- Pension scheme
- Flexible working options
This full-time role offers substantial opportunities for career growth.
